Output ae66615fa3ead9d6cd7189191547743299c603a10ac98845e2185ee9b7ceb5a4:3

value
66249
script pubkey
OP_0 OP_PUSHBYTES_20 88fe7953bbb59a00d626ee60cfd932ff4a00448f
address
tb1q3rl8j5amkkdqp43xaesvlkfjla9qq3y0tanzq8
transaction
ae66615fa3ead9d6cd7189191547743299c603a10ac98845e2185ee9b7ceb5a4